Output c660a2d05ab56272ae1a9e26d829925a1d14edfeca82bc2019416ab63c44e86c:0

value
12560902
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ec648a7493fc6da0397c148b4499347bd35eadcf0bb46b995410a9be553375b2
address
bc1pa3jg5aynl3k6qwtuzj95fxf500f4atw0pw6xhx25zz5mu4fnwkeqjsmmjn
transaction
c660a2d05ab56272ae1a9e26d829925a1d14edfeca82bc2019416ab63c44e86c
confirmations
170312
spent
true